HTML content can be minified and compressed by a website’s server. The most efficient way is to compress content using GZIP which reduces data amount travelling through the network between server and browser. Image size optimization can help to speed up a website loading time. The chart above shows the difference between the size before and after optimization. Obviously, Fcps needs image optimization as it can save up to 5.7 kB or 20% of the original volume. The most popular and efficient tools for JPEG and PNG image optimization are Jpegoptim and PNG Crush.
